- the invention relates to a device for printing and dispensing self-adhesive labels adhering to a carrier tape, with an operating lever which, from a rest position in which it holds a printing unit lifted from a printing table, into a working position in which it attaches the printing unit to the system
- the printing table holds, is pivotable, a transport device for gradually pulling the carrier tape over the printing table and around a dispensing edge at which the self-adhesive labels detach from the carrier tape and reach a dispensing position, and a braking device for clamping the carrier tape with the self-adhesive labels adhering to it on the way to the dispensing edge in the rest position of the operating lever.
- a self-adhesive label can be brought into the dispensing position by first pulling an operating lever and then releasing it again. While the lever is being pulled on, the label in the device is imprinted by lowering the printing unit onto the label on the printing table by means of the printing unit lever. The imprint can be, for example, a price or an article number.
- the transport device grips the carrier tape and pulls it around the dispensing edge by a piece corresponding to the label length.
- the label peels off and reaches the dispensing position below a pressure roller. The label can now be stuck to an object by unrolling the pressure roller.
- the brake device used in the known device is jammed so that the carrier tape is not pulled back on the object during the application of the label due to any glue bridges present or due to incomplete separation from the subsequent label, so that the subsequent label no longer assumes the correct printing position on the printing table the carrier tape on the way to the printing table only when the operating lever is in its rest position. As soon as the operating lever is pulled against the handle of the device, the clamping action of the braking device is released so that the carrier tape can move.
- the invention has for its object to design a bone of the type mentioned in such a way that a quick succession of the operating steps required when using the device is made possible without the accuracy of the application of the printing on the labels in the device suffering.
- the braking device contains a brake actuator that is non-positively pressed into a carrier tape clamping position, from which it can be pivoted into a carrier tape release position that a cam mechanism is arranged between the brake actuator and the operating lever is designed so that the brake actuator is pivoted from the carrier tape clamping position into the carrier tape release position when the operating lever has covered part of its way from the rest position into the working position, and that a lock is provided which the brake actuator in the carrier tape Release position locked and released as soon as the operating lever reaches its rest position.
- the carrier tape is not only clamped by the braking device in the rest position of the operating lever, but also it is also retained when the operating lever has already covered part of its entire path from the rest position.
- a retraction of the carrier tape and thus a shifting of the label located on the printing table can therefore not take place if the individual operations required for attaching a label to an object are carried out very quickly in succession or even merge, or if for another reason the Operating lever has been moved somewhat from its rest position during the application of the label.
- FIGS. 1 to 4 show the device according to the invention in four successive operating phases.
- the device shown in Fig. 1 is provided with a housing 1 to which a handle 2 is attached.
- a shaft 3 for receiving a supply roll 4 of a carrier tape 5 with self-adhesive labels 6 is attached to the top of the housing.
- the carrier tape 5 runs in the device from the shaft 3 first downward and then forward to a dispensing edge 7, at which the carrier tape 5 is deflected and passed past a transport device 8 to the rear end of the housing.
- a pressure roller 9 is rotatably mounted in the housing, with which a label 6 'detached from the carrier tape and in the dispensing position can be glued to an object.
- An operating lever 10 is attached below the handle 2 and is mounted rotatably about an axis 11. Between the handle 2 and the operating lever 10 is one Mounted spring 12, which always tries to push the lever into the rest position shown in Fig. 1. In the housing 1 there is also a printing unit lever 13, which is also rotatably mounted about the axis 11. This printing unit lever 13 carries a printing unit 14, by means of which a self-adhesive label 6 located on a printing table 15 can be printed. Between an arm 16 of the operating lever 10 and the printing unit lever 13, a spring 17 is attached, which serves to transmit a movement of the operating lever 10 directed towards the handle to the printing unit lever 13. In the rest position shown in FIG. 1, the printing unit lever 13 is held in the raised position by a lug 18 on the operating lever 10.
- the carrier tape 5 On its way from the supply roll 4 to the printing table 15 and to the dispensing edge 7, the carrier tape 5 is passed under a brake plate 19 which is rotatably mounted about an axis 20.
- a brake actuator 21 is also rotatably mounted on this axis, which has the shape of an angle lever with a pressure arm 22 acting on the brake plate 19 and a locking arm 23 projecting generally upwards in FIG. 1.
- a spring 24 On the axis 20, a spring 24 is attached, which biases the brake actuator 21 in the representation of FIG. 1 counterclockwise.
- this spring 24 has a leg 25 which engages with the brake actuating member 21 and a further leg 27 which engages with a support surface 26 fixed to the housing.
- the brake actuator 21 is provided with a control edge 28 which cooperates with a control member 29 formed by a roller on the printing unit lever 13, as will be explained in more detail later.
- the brake actuator 21, the control edge 28 attached to it and the control member 29 together form a cam mechanism.
- the locking arm 23 of the Brake actuator 21 cooperates with a lock 30 formed by a square axis, which is mounted so that it can move in the view of Fig. 1 in the vertical direction, being biased downward by a spring 31 used to achieve a bias becomes.
- the locking mechanism 30 is raised by the printing mechanism lever 13 against the force of the spring 31 when it assumes its rest position shown in FIG. 1.
- the locking arm 23 of the brake actuator 21 can pivot under the action of the spring 24 under the locking 30, so that the locking arm 23 holds it in the raised position, even if the printing unit lever 13 moves again moved down.
- the operating lever 10 takes on its lowest position due to the action of the spring 12, and the printing unit lever 13 is held by the nose 18 on the operating lever 10 so that the printing unit 14 is in its highest position.
- the printing unit lever 13 also presses the lock 30 upwards so that it does not hinder a rotation of the brake actuator 21 under the action of the spring 24 counterclockwise.
- the brake actuator 21 is pivoted by the spring 24 so that the locking arm 23 has come under the lock 30 and its pressure arm 22 presses the brake plate 19 against the pressure table 15 in a carrier tape clamping position, so that between the brake member 19 and the pressure table 15th running carrier tape is clamped.
- the control member 29 touches the control edge 28 on the brake actuating member 21, so that this brake actuating member 21 is pivoted clockwise against the action of the spring 24 into the carrier tape release position.
- This pivoting has the result that the pressure arm 22 lifts up from the brake plate 19 and that the locking arm 23 releases the way of the lock 30 downward.
- the pressure arm 22 is lifted when the operating lever 10 has covered a third of its way from the rest position to the working position.
- Fig. 3 the printing unit lever 13 is shown in the fully lowered working position, in which the printing unit 14 produces an imprint on the label 6 located on the printing table 15.
- the brake actuator 21 is pivoted in the clockwise direction in the release position, so that the pressure arm 22 is lifted from the brake plate 19.
- the lock 30 holds the brake actuator 21 in the pivoted position.
- Fig. 4 shows the arrangement of the moving parts between the two end positions of the operating lever 10.
- the control member 29 is no longer in engagement with the control edge 28 on the brake actuator 21, but can this brake actuator 21 does not rotate clockwise under the action of the spring 24, since it is prevented by the lock 30. This means that the carrier tape is not clamped between the brake plate 19 and the printing table 15 in this operating phase.
- the transport device 8 performs a movement from the position shown in FIG. 3 to the position shown in FIG. 1 in the course of the return movement of the operating lever 10 caused by the spring 12, but now firmly engages with the carrier tape 5 stands so that this is pulled by a defined distance, which is equal to the length of a self-adhesive label, around the dispensing edge 7.
- a self-adhesive label is detached from the carrier tape 5 and reaches the dispensing position below the pressure roller 9.
- the carrier tape movement is not impeded by the brake plate 19, since this, like was already mentioned, is not pressed by the pressure arm 22 of the brake actuator 21 against the pressure table 15 in this operating phase.
- the printing mechanism lever 13 abuts against the lock 30 and lifts it so far that it is no longer in engagement with the locking arm 23 of the brake actuator 21.
- the brake actuator 21 can therefore rotate counterclockwise under the action of the spring 24. Due to this rotation, the pressure arm 22 of the brake actuator 21 comes into contact with the brake plate 19 again, so that the underlying carrier tape is clamped on the printing table.
- the self-adhesive label 6 'in the dispensing position can be stuck onto an object by rolling off the pressure roller 9.
- the importance of the brake device formed by the brake plate 19 and the brake actuator 21 becomes apparent.
- the label which still adheres to the carrier tape 5 with the edge region must be completely detached from the carrier tape. It happens that the label 6 'in the dispensing position is not completely separated from the next label 6 or that its glue layer is still with the glue layer of the next one Label is connected, so that when the dispensed label 6 'is attached to the object, a tensile force is exerted on the carrier tape 5. If there were no braking device, the carrier tape 5 could move on the printing table 15, so that the label 6 to be printed next is no longer in the correct printing position.
- the braking device described not only clamps the carrier tape firmly during the application of the label 6 'in the dispensing position, but it is also effective during part of the movement of the operating lever 10 against the handle 2 when the next printing and transport operation is carried out.
- This has the advantageous effect that the carrier tape is still securely clamped to an object during the application of a self-adhesive label even if the operating lever 10 is already pulled against the handle 2 again for the next printing and transport operation.
- This enables rapid working with the device described, the operations of attaching a label and actuating the lever 10 sometimes even being able to pass into one another without the carrier tape 5 being able to be moved on the printing table.
- the label print can therefore be attached exactly to the intended location on each label.
